IM通讯软件开发中的语音识别技术有哪些?

在IM(即时通讯)软件开发中,语音识别技术已经成为提升用户体验、增强交互方式的重要手段。随着人工智能技术的不断发展,语音识别技术在IM通讯软件中的应用越来越广泛。以下是一些常见的语音识别技术在IM通讯软件开发中的应用:

  1. 语音转文字(Speech-to-Text,STT)
    语音转文字技术是语音识别技术中最基础也是应用最广泛的一种。它可以将用户的语音输入实时转换为文字,从而实现语音输入文本消息的功能。在IM通讯软件中,语音转文字技术可以应用于以下场景:

(1)实时语音聊天:用户可以通过语音输入进行实时聊天,提高沟通效率。
(2)语音输入消息:用户可以将语音输入的消息发送给好友,实现语音与文字的转换。
(3)语音搜索:用户可以通过语音输入关键词,快速查找相关消息或联系人。


  1. 语音识别搜索
    语音识别搜索技术允许用户通过语音输入关键词,实现快速搜索功能。在IM通讯软件中,语音识别搜索技术可以应用于以下场景:

(1)联系人搜索:用户可以通过语音输入联系人姓名或关键词,快速找到对应联系人。
(2)消息搜索:用户可以通过语音输入关键词,快速查找历史消息或重要信息。
(3)功能搜索:用户可以通过语音输入指令,快速打开或使用通讯软件中的各种功能。


  1. 语音识别翻译
    语音识别翻译技术可以将用户的语音输入实时翻译成目标语言,实现跨语言沟通。在IM通讯软件中,语音识别翻译技术可以应用于以下场景:

(1)跨语言聊天:用户可以与不同语言的朋友进行语音聊天,实现无障碍沟通。
(2)国际交流:用户可以与海外朋友进行语音交流,了解不同国家的文化。
(3)旅游出行:用户可以借助语音识别翻译技术,轻松应对海外旅行中的语言障碍。


  1. 语音识别情绪识别
    语音识别情绪识别技术可以分析用户的语音语调,判断其情绪状态。在IM通讯软件中,语音识别情绪识别技术可以应用于以下场景:

(1)情绪表达:用户可以通过语音表达自己的情绪,使聊天更加生动有趣。
(2)心理辅导:在心理咨询等领域,语音识别情绪识别技术可以帮助专业人员进行情绪分析,提供更有针对性的帮助。
(3)个性化推荐:根据用户情绪状态,通讯软件可以推荐相关话题或功能,提升用户体验。


  1. 语音识别语音合成(Text-to-Speech,TTS)
    语音合成技术可以将文字内容转换为语音输出,实现语音播报功能。在IM通讯软件中,语音合成技术可以应用于以下场景:

(1)语音播报消息:用户可以将文字消息转换为语音,方便在嘈杂环境中接收信息。
(2)语音播报联系人信息:通讯软件可以自动播报联系人姓名或昵称,方便用户识别。
(3)语音播报功能提示:在软件操作过程中,通讯软件可以语音播报功能提示,帮助用户快速了解操作步骤。


  1. 语音识别语音控制
    语音控制技术允许用户通过语音指令控制通讯软件的各种功能。在IM通讯软件中,语音控制技术可以应用于以下场景:

(1)语音发送消息:用户可以通过语音指令发送消息,提高沟通效率。
(2)语音切换聊天:用户可以通过语音指令切换聊天对象,实现多窗口操作。
(3)语音搜索联系人:用户可以通过语音指令搜索联系人,快速找到对应联系人。

总之,语音识别技术在IM通讯软件中的应用越来越广泛,为用户提供了更加便捷、智能的沟通方式。随着人工智能技术的不断发展,未来语音识别技术在IM通讯软件中的应用将更加丰富,为用户带来更加优质的使用体验。

猜你喜欢:即时通讯系统